Ordinals
beta
Sat 320424292691609
decimal
64084.4292691609
degree
0°64084′1588″4292691609‴
percentile
15.258299668765519%
name
lossxvqlfsa
cycle
0
epoch
0
period
31
block
64084
offset
4292691609
timestamp
2010-07-03 16:28:05 UTC
rarity
common
prev
next